My 2003 V70 D5 regulary (every 10-20k) develops a fault where under hard acceleration the engine hesitates & then goes into 'limp home' mode with the message 'Urgent engine service required'.
On stopping & restarting the engine it clears & drives Ok until you accelerate hard, when he problem re -occurs. It then gets progressively worse until the car is un driveable. On each occassion it has turned out to be the Bosch fuel metering valve that has gone faulty & usually ends up costing me £200 plus with diagnostics & labour.... Read more
I would suggest that the fuel tank pick up is cleaned and the intank filter or pre- filter.
i suspect you may have a bacteria issue in the tank, causing a fine black film causing metering valve problems....
